Ingredients

Dressing Ingredients

  • ¾ cup mayonnaise
  • ¾ cup sour cream
  • ⅓ cup grated Parmesan
  • 2 tbsp granulated sugar
  • 1 tsp onion powder

Salad Ingredients

  • 5 cups chopped romaine
  • 3 medium tomatoes (seeded and diced)
  • 1 bunch green onions (sliced)
  • 8 hard boiled eggs (peeled and chopped)
  • 2 cups frozen peas (thawed)
  • 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ese
  • 1 lb turkey bacon (cooked and crumbled)

How to Make 7 Layer Salad

Step 1: Prepare the Dressing

In a mixing bowl, combine the mayonnaise, sour cream, grated Parmesan, sugar, and onion powder. Mix until smooth and set aside.

Step 2: Layer Your Ingredients

In a clear serving dish:
1. Start with a layer of chopped romaine lettuce at the bottom.
2. Spread half of the dressing over the romaine evenly.
3. Add a layer of diced tomatoes followed by sliced green onions.
4. Sprinkle half of the chopped hard-boiled eggs over the green onions.
5. Next, add a layer of thawed peas.

Step 3: Continue Layering

  1. Add another layer of dressing over the peas.
  2. Follow with the remaining chopped hard-boiled eggs and then top with shredded cheddar cheese.
  3. Finally, finish off with crumbled turkey bacon on top.

Step 4: Chill Before Serving

Cover your salad with plastic wrap and refrigerate for at least an hour before serving to allow flavors to meld together.

Storage & Reheating Instructions

Refrigerator Storage

  • Store leftover 7 Layer Salad in an airtight container.
  • It will stay fresh in the refrigerator for up to 3 days.

Freezing 7 Layer Salad

  • Freezing is not recommended, as it may affect texture and flavor.
  • If necessary, freeze individual components separately, but avoid freezing the assembled salad.

How many servings does this recipe provide?

This recipe serves about 12 people, making it perfect for gatherings or potlucks.

What can I use instead of mayonnaise?

You can substitute mayonnaise with Greek yogurt or a vegan mayo alternative for a lighter option.

How long does it take to prepare a 7 Layer Salad?

Preparation takes about 15 minutes, making it a quick and easy dish for any occasion.

Can I make this salad ahead of time?

Absolutely! You can prepare the salad a day in advance and store it in the refrigerator until ready to serve.
